The man used the “Your Keys to the City” public piano in Denver, which encouraged passersby to stop and enjoy the music. A sign is seen on the side of the decorated piano, saying “We invite you to play this piano at your leisure.”

It’s no secret that Queen’s “Bohemian Rhapsody” has had quite a successful path since it’s release in 1975. It has been in the Grammy Hall of Fame since 2004 and was announced as the 20th century’s “most streamed song,” with the music video sitting at 1.1 billion views on YouTube.
